Are Property Taxes A Scheme for Government Land Grabs? Trent Exposes the Truth

Are property taxes just a way for the government to take more land from hardworking Americans? On this episode of Trent on the Loos, Trent Loos sits down with Pennington County commission candidate Mike Mueller and former South Dakota State Senator Julie Frey-Mueller to tackle this pressing question. With more people questioning the fairness of property taxes, the movement to abolish them in South Dakota is gaining momentum. Mike and Julie break down the argument that property taxes put landowners at constant risk—because if they can’t afford to pay, the government is ready to step in and take what’s theirs. They expose how this system punishes responsible citizens who have worked hard to own property, yet are forced to keep paying the government just to stay on the land they already bought and paid for. They also dig into how government officials defend this tax, claiming it funds essential services, but at what cost? Shouldn’t there be a better way to fund infrastructure and schools that doesn’t involve threatening people with losing their land? Trent, Mike, and Julie don’t just raise concerns—they explore real solutions, from alternative tax structures to better fiscal responsibility at the government level. As they peel back the layers, one thing becomes clear: property taxes aren’t just about revenue, they’re about control. Tune in as they expose the dangers of allowing government overreach to creep further into private land ownership and discuss how citizens can take action before it’s too late.
